The card I’m sharing with you today is a design I created for cards for my team earlier this month.


 I wanted to use the Dove of Hope bundle in a non-Christmas way. 

I combined the Dove die cut with the pretty Ornate Garden Designer Series paper and I was quite happy with the end result!
